What is Rhinoplasty?

Rhinoplasty is a type of cosmetic procedure done to improve different aspects of your nose. It’s designed to change your nose shape and size. It may also be done for medical reasons. People who have breathing problems or birth-related nose disfigurements, or trauma-related nose disfigurements may also opt for rhinoplasty in order to correct these functional issues.

How Does Rhinoplasty Work?

A rhinoplasty is an outpatient procedure that can be done in a couple of hours. It is generally done under an anesthetic to help ease discomfort. Your cosmetic surgeon will usually start by making incisions in your nostrils.

He will then re-shape your nose structure to give it a more aesthetically pleasing look. If your nose job requires a lot of corrections, your cosmetic surgeon may have to cut across your nose’s base and then use the cartilage and bone to reshape it.

After the Rhinoplasty Procedure

Once the surgery is completed, your doctor will close the surgical area and secure it with a splint. You will have to wear this splint for at least one-week after the surgery. You may have some bruising, swelling, and redness around your nose. These should heal within two to three weeks.

You may also have some slight not-so-conspicuous swelling in your nose which will take slightly longer to heal. Once this heals, the final shape of your nose will be set and your entire facial appearance will be improved significantly.

You need to follow the post-surgical care instructions given to you carefully. Avoid physically straining activities for at least a month after your surgery.
